Purpose of the role Affinia is seeking to recruit 2 highly organised Business Analysts to join the Integration Management Office, managing the integration of multiple businesses per year as part of our private equity growth journey. These newly created roles place the Business Analyst in a critical position, bridging the gap between business needs and technology solutions. The BA will translate company objectives into actionable requirements for Business Change and IT projects, and will travel to most office locations including Brighton, the South East, Essex and East Anglia.
This Critical Role Will Be Responsible For
Documenting end‑to‑end business processes across the organisation for different client and employee journeys.
Collaborating with key stakeholders at all levels of the business up to and including C‑Suite.
Mapping target acquisition business processes to the Affinia standard and identifying gaps and required changes post‑acquisition.
Identifying opportunities to drive business value through process optimisation, system functionality enhancement and continuous improvement initiatives.
Accountabilities Stakeholder Engagement
Build strong relationships with business SMEs, department heads and key stakeholders.
Facilitate workshops, meetings and interviews to elicit and capture requirements, identify challenges and explore improvement opportunities.
Communicate complex concepts and solutions clearly and concisely to appropriate audiences.
Act as a transformation partner for our multiple business areas, helping them understand the impact of change.
Business Analysis
Lead planning, execution, monitoring, controlling and closing of analysis components for high‑complexity projects and programmes.
Conduct research in the discovery phase, defining problems and crafting service‑design propositions.
Facilitate the creation of design artefacts (personas, as‑is and future‑state journeys, service blueprints, prototypes, etc.).
Document and analyse business requirements, ensuring accuracy and alignment with business goals.
Collaborate with technical teams to translate requirements into system design and functionality.
Define acceptance criteria, support testing and defect triage to validate solutions meet business needs.
Ensure all deliverables meet the highest quality standards and comply with organisational and industry best practices.
Review and walkthrough business requirements and functional specifications with stakeholders.
Analyse business processes, identify inefficiencies and recommend solutions to optimise performance.
Support workflow streamlining initiatives to improve overall operations.
Use data‑driven analysis to support decision‑making and provide actionable insights.
Stay current with industry trends, emerging technologies and best practices in business analysis and project management.
Promote a culture of continuous improvement by encouraging innovation and implementing best practices.
